Click on the Start () button. In the Start Menu Search Box type msconfig. Then press enter on your keyboard. The System Configuration utility will open. Make sure Startup Selection is set for Normal Startup. Click on the Boot tab. Make sure Safe boot is unchecked. Press the Apply button and then press the OK button.

One way it can get "stuck" in Safe Mode is via the "boot.ini" file. After booting to Safe Mode, do. Start -> Run -> "msconfig". To get Microsoft Outlook out of safe mode, you need to close it and restart it outside of safe mode. To do this, open Task Manager and find Outlook in the list of processes. You should now be able to use the controller to navigate the menu. Originally posted by godfather: Go to "engine_config.txt" in the Bannerlord file (should in Documents). Find "safely_exited" and set it to 0 instead of 1. Bannerlord will prompt you again on reopening if you want to enable Safe Mode. Press "no". Press Windows + R keys to open Run command. Type msconfig and press Enter. In the System Configuration window, click on General tab. Safe Mode is a diagnostic startup mode in Windows operating systems that's used as a way to gain limited access to Windows when the operating system won't start normally. Normal Mode, then, is the opposite of Safe Mode in that it starts Windows in its typical manner.
